The Feit Electric BPESL13T/GU24 is a 60-watt equivalent CFL bulb designed to replace traditional incandescent bulbs. With its GU24 base, this energy-efficient lighting solution offers up to 10,000 hours of use, making it a smart choice for eco-conscious consumers. Okay bulb but too bright & white for use - it will wake you up
The bulbs arrived on time, not broken and they work.Unfortunately "daylight" in CFL does not mean what it meant for incandescent bulbs. These bulbs a very harsh, very bright, very white fluorescent-looking bright-snow-white color that will make it hard to relax near them.Not like yellow-sunlight or the slightly less yellow (but not snow white) of "daylight" in incandescentThis will totally waike you up. Maybe good for eating breakfast under, but not good for relaxing over dinner or putting in a bedroom.Like coffee these lights will WAKE YOU UP. If you use them after 5pm they will make it harder to sleep.Best bet is to read online about Kelvin Temperature. For light that is a more relaxing, yellow tone, you want 2700k, and less the 3000kThe Kelvin rating of these bulbs (at this time at least) is 5,000 - very high. Unfortunately the Amazon Seller does not provide the Kelvin rating of these and they are not on the packaging, either. The packaging these bulbs come in does not list the Kelvin rating either. The only way to find the Kelvin rating is the tiny print on the base of the builb that you can only see after opening the package.Sad to see lack of transparency here, especially by the manufacturer.While maybe I should know about Kelvin Temperature, our society and technology is changing and the Kelvin rating is new to most people. The vendor and manufacturer should explain it - at least to openly list the rating as other Amazon vendors do.So I won't totally fault them for sending me a color I didn't want but points off for not listing the Kelvin rating and saying what it means.
